Weather in April

April in Martinsville, Texas, is a warm spring month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 55.8°F (13.2°C) and an average high of 76.8°F (24.9°C).

Temperature

April brings a slight rise in Martinsville's average high-temperature, moving from an agreeable 68.7°F (20.4°C) in March to a warm 76.8°F (24.9°C). An average low-temperature of 55.8°F (13.2°C) is expected in Martinsville, Texas, during April.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in April in Martinsville, Texas, is 75%.

Rainfall

In April, the rain falls for 13.3 days. Throughout April, 3.58" (91mm) of precipitation is accumulated. In Martinsville, Texas, during the entire year, the rain falls for 160.4 days and collects up to 35.83" (910m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

April through August, October and November are months without snowfall in Martinsville.

Daylight

In April, the average length of the day is 12h and 58min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:05 am and sunset at 7:37 pm. On the last day of April, in Martinsville, sunrise is at 6:32 am and sunset at 7:57 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in April in Martinsville is 8.6h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in April is 5.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
